《全套国标软件设计文档》是一份非常全面的资源,涵盖了软件开发的各个阶段所需的规范性文档。这些文档是确保软件开发过程系统化、规范化、高效化的关键工具,旨在提高团队协作效率,降低沟通成本,确保产品质量。下面,我们将详细讨论其中涉及到的主要知识点。
我们来关注"数据要求说明书"。这份文档主要描述了软件系统中所涉及的数据类型、结构、格式以及它们之间的关系。它明确了数据的来源、处理方式、存储需求,以及如何确保数据的安全性和完整性。在设计阶段,数据要求说明书为数据库设计和接口设计提供了基础,对软件的数据处理能力进行预规划。
"详细设计说明书"是软件开发过程中的重要环节。它详细描述了每个模块的功能、算法选择、输入输出参数、内部数据结构以及模块间的接口。通过这份文档,开发人员可以明确地理解每个功能的实现细节,确保编码工作与设计意图一致。详细设计说明书还有助于在项目中发现潜在问题,提前进行调整。
接下来是"概要设计说明书",它在软件设计的早期阶段产生,是对整个系统的一个高层次的描述。这份文档包含了系统架构、主要模块的划分、模块间的关系、预期性能等信息。概要设计说明书为详细设计提供了一个框架,帮助团队把握整体方向,避免在后期出现大的设计改动。
除此之外,还有其他关键文档,例如"需求规格说明书",它定义了软件的功能需求和非功能需求,包括用户界面、性能、安全性等方面的要求。"系统架构设计"则描绘了系统的总体结构,包括硬件、软件、网络等方面的配置。"测试计划"和"测试报告"则分别规定了测试策略、方法和预期结果,以及实际测试过程和结果的记录。
在软件开发过程中,这些文档不仅用于内部团队沟通,也是与客户、管理层以及外部供应商交流的重要依据。它们确保所有参与者对项目的理解一致,从而降低了误解和冲突的可能性,提高了项目成功的可能性。
《全套国标软件设计文档》是一个全面的指导集合,对于任何从事软件开发工作的专业人员来说,都是不可或缺的参考资料。通过理解和应用这些文档,可以提升软件开发的专业水平,保证项目按照既定标准和流程进行,最终产出高质量的软件产品。
2025-06-22 15:03:31
114KB
软件设计文档
1